Curriculum relevance
England
Key Stage 2
Programme of study: Science
Sc2 Life processes and living things; Humans and other animals
- 2c: that the heart acts as a pump to circulate the blood through vessels around the body, including through the lungs
- 2d: about the effect of exercise and rest on pulse rate
QCA scheme of work primary science unit 5A: Keeping healthy
Wales
Key Stage 2
Programme of study: Science
Life processes and living things; Humans and other animals
- 2.4: that the heart acts as a pump
- 2.5: how blood circulates in the body through arteries and veins
- 2.6: that the pulse rate gives a measure of the heart beat rate
- 2.7: the effect of exercise and rest on pulse rate
Northern Ireland
Key Stage 2
Programme of study: Science and technology
Living things; Ourselves
- e: investigate how basic life processes including circulation, simple respiration and digestion relate in order to maintain healthy bodies
Scotland
Environmental studies: 5-14 National guidelines
Science; Living things and the processes of life; The processes of life
- Level C: identify the main organs of the human body
- Level C: describe the broad functions of the organs of the human body
